Today, we're diving into a Reddit post that hits close to home for many entrepreneurs—dealing with the gut punch of finding out someone else is already running with your million-dollar idea.
In this reaction video, we explore a Reddit post by user special_abrocoma4641, who shares their struggle with stumbling upon existing solutions to their ideas.
🔍 Key Takeaways:
Ideas Are Not Everything: It's not about having a completely original idea; it's about execution.
Google Around, But Watch Your Vocabulary: Sometimes, it's not the lack of competitors, but the use of different terms in the industry that makes it seem like your idea is unique.
Competitors Can Be Your Best Teachers: Rather than being discouraged, competitors offer valuable insights into market research, strategies, and customer personas.
Disruption vs. Luxury Service: Learn when to disrupt an overserved segment or provide a luxury experience for an underserved one. Understanding your customer is key!
